About Bertie
Hi everyone! My name is Bertie, and I'm looking for my special forever home that will suit my quirky personality and magnificent ear hair!
I love chasing balls, playing with my foster mum's rugs, playing in my cat tunnel, chasing my foster brother, and anything that involves playtime! I have lots of energy and would love to live somewhere with a nice big house or garden that I can tear around. I'd love a brother or sister - a young cat who loves to play just as much as me but who will also snuggle with me.
At the end of a long day playing, I love a snuggle and a chat. When my foster mum gets home I walk around meowing and jumping around telling her all the exciting things that happened to me - she says I am a funny little man.
I can be shy at first - I didn't grow up around humans, so for the first little while I like to hide, it makes me feel safe. But after a couple of hours I am all up in your face demanding attention and play time. I need a brush a couple of times a week to keep me handsome, and because I have pale features I'd need to be kept out of the sun.
I would be ok living with older children who understand that I might need some time and space to come out of my shell. I have lived with a dog and was ok, and I absolutely love other cats.I am completely litter trained and a good eater, but not fussy. I would love to meet you!
